Artist's Description

This is a restored copy of Frances Densmore, US Government Bureau of Ethnology recording Blackfoot tribe Native American Indian chief Mountain Chief in 1916. Densmore appears to be using an early Thomas Edison gramophone.

About Peter Ogden

Peter Ogden

I have been a visual artist since the 1960s. I'm originally from Orange County, New York, located in the Metro New York City region where I was raised on the working dairy farm [Ogden Farm] which my family founded in 1832. As a young man I spent many long hours working in gardens, crop fields, pastures and in barns with livestock. I grew up surrounded by antiques. I graduated from Bucknell University where I majored in art which included a semester in Florence studying Italian Renaissance art. After Bucknell I studied at the School of Visual Arts in Manhattan.
